Abstract
A group of control registers for controlling a plurality of input output devices respectively are formed in random access memory which is connected to a microprocessor bus of an input output control device. A history of a program mode access from a central processing apparatus to the RAM is recorded in a first-in first-out memory (FIFO). The microprocessor of the input output control device reads an access information of the FIFO, accesses the group of the control registers on the RAM, and controls the input output device according to the read control information. Thus, control of a plurality of input output devices is carried out by one input output device.
